tkinter如何设置字体颜色
时间: 2024-05-24 21:08:21 浏览: 318
python tkinter guide
在Tkinter中,你可以通过设置标签(Label)或文本框(Text)的属性来改变字体颜色。下面是一些代码示例:
1. 使用Label控件设置字体颜色:
```python
import tkinter as tk
root = tk.Tk()
label = tk.Label(root, text="Hello World!", fg="red")
label.pack()
root.mainloop()
```
2. 使用Text控件设置字体颜色:
```python
import tkinter as tk
root = tk.Tk()
text = tk.Text(root)
text.insert(tk.END, "Hello World!")
text.tag_add("color", "1.0", "end")
text.tag_config("color", foreground="red")
text.pack()
root.mainloop()
```
在上面的代码中,我们首先创建了一个文本框(Text)控件,然后使用insert方法插入了一段文本。接着,我们使用tag_add方法将名为“color”的标签应用到了整个文本框中的文本。最后,我们使用tag_config方法来设置名为“color”的标签的前景色(foreground)为红色(red)。
阅读全文